Prized repertory favorites combined with bold new additions create an adventurous season of world-class performances. PNB's 2008–2009 subscribers can anticipate:
  • Two premieres by Twyla Tharp created specially for PNB
  • The full-evening George Balanchine Jewels
  • A Broadway festival of works celebrating the Great White Way
  • PNB's hugely popular Swan Lake
  • New works by such dance luminaries as Benjamin Millepied, Mark Morris, and Christopher Wheeldon
  • ...and more!

Are you between the ages of 21-39?
Consider a Backstage Pass subscription! Members enjoy generous subscription discounts, hosted intermissions, parties with dancers and artistic staff, and engaging educational events.
